草庐IT

Keil_debug

全部标签

iOS - 在 Debug模式下连接 Xcode 的后台模式

我在我的应用程序中使用背景音频模式播放音乐,但当轨道列表在轨道之间跳过时,应用程序被关闭。我跟踪这个错误的问题是,当我在连接Xcode的Debug模式下运行应用程序时,应用程序将永远留在前台!有没有办法告诉Xcode让应用进入它的后台模式,Xcode在Debug模式下连接? 最佳答案 要模拟后台获取,请启动您的应用,然后转到Xcode并选择“调试”>“模拟后台获取”。您还可以配置一个方案来控制Xcode如何启动您的应用程序。要使您的应用程序直接启动到暂停状态,请选择产品>方案>编辑方案并选中后台获取复选框。

keil_5创建STM32工程,超详细

1、点击Project创建新的工程文件2、新建一个文件夹作为工程目录,命名为2-2STM32工程模板。      在该工程目录下给工程文件命名为Project3、选择器件型号,因为使用的芯片型号是STM32F103C8T6,所以型号选STM32F103C8,后点击OK.4、工程创建好后,里面是空的,需要为其添加必要的文件5、添加启动文件 找到下面这些启动文件文件,将其全部拷贝到Start目录中6、在工程目录下创建一个文件Start用来存放启动文件目录,将上面的信息全部拷贝到Start目录中7、①stm32f10x.h文件,是STM32的外设寄存器描述文件,用来描述STM’32有哪些寄存器和它对

ios - react native : How to debug release build?

我已经使用ReactNative构建了一个应用程序,它在Debug模式下完美运行,但是在运行发布版本时,它在导航到场景时失败了。Xcode控制台显示一条神秘的错误消息(可能是因为缩小)。我不知道如何从这个错误中得到更多?有没有什么方法可以通过不同的捆绑方式或查看其他地方来获取更多信息?[tid:com.facebook.react.JavaScript]TypeError:undefinedisnotanobject(evaluating'e.default')Thiserrorislocatedat:inrintinRCTViewinRCTViewintintinRCTViewinn

ios - 在 Debug模式下,API 请求有效。 Release模式,返回 null

我使用iOS模拟器来测试我的react-native应用程序已经接近完成。在Debug模式下,api请求成功工作并显示在应用程序上。但是,在Release模式下,只有登录请求有效。我目前的详细信息如下:react-native:0.60.3,native-base:2.13.5,react-native-cli:2.0.1,VisualStudioCode1.36.1Xcode11beta7我做了以下事情:将域添加到info.plist中的权限使用不同的API服务器来查看是否是我使用的服务器导致了问题尝试在Xcode中使用调试和Release模式进行不同的优化此登录API请求有效并返回

iphone - 辅助线程的堆栈大小,DEBUG 和 RELEASE 版本之间的显着差异

在我的iPhone应用程序(XCode3.2.4,iOS3.1.3)中,如果我在RELEASE模式下运行应用程序,一切都很好,但在DEBUG模式下,应用程序崩溃并出现EXC_BAD_ACCESS异常。该应用程序执行一些复杂的计算。所有主要代码都包含在几个C++静态库中,UIApplication仅从这些库之一创建对象并调用该对象的方法。如果我将调用复杂计算的代码放入辅助线程,我仍然有相同的行为:在DEBUG模式下出现EXC_BAD_ACCESS异常,在RELEASE模式下没有问题。然后我查看了线程堆栈大小。默认情况下,iOS为辅助线程设置线程堆栈大小为512KB,为主线程设置为1024

iphone - 如何在项目build设置中指定 DEBUG 定义?

我正在尝试在http://www.cimgf.com/2010/05/02/my-current-prefix-pch-file/上实现日志记录方法.我不确定如何完成该步骤:Thereforethefirstlineisaswitchtoseeifweareindebugmode.Isetthisvalueinthebuildsettingsofmyproject.Ifyoulookunderthe“PreprocessorMacros”sectionyoucansettheDEBUGdefinitionthere.这是为了满足代码中的“#ifdefDEBUG”条目(我只给出第一行)。

【STM32-DSP库的使用】基于Keil5 + STM32CubeMX + CMSIS-DSP 手动添加、库添加方式

STM32-DSP库的使用一.CMSIS-DSP1.1DSP库简介1.2支持的函数类别1.3宏定义二、操作2.1STM32CubeMX配置基本工程2.2Lib库的方式实现(推荐)2.3手动添加DSP文件(可以下载官方最新库,功能齐全)三、MFCC测试DSP加速效果为验证语音识别MFCC用到快速傅里叶变换FFT,在工程中应用DSP库时对着网上各种教程暴雷难受,希望给大家提供帮助;并且以lib库、手动src移植两种方式分别实现;测试环境Crotex-M4实测有效(相比于Cortex-M3增加了浮点运算单元和数字信号处理(DSP)指令集,适用于需要处理复杂算法的应用);一.CMSIS-DSP1.1D

Keil MDK 6 的使用教程来了

关注+星标公众号,不错过精彩内容作者 | strongerHuang微信公众号| strongerHuang很多读者都比较关心KeilMDK6的消息。。。KeilMDK6来了吗?KeilMDK6和KeilStudio桌面版什么关系?KeilStudio桌面版就是VSCode插件吗?KeilStudio桌面版如何使用?······虽然Keil被很多网友吐槽存在各种不足,但目前主流的单片机(MCU)开发工具,使用较多的依然还是Keil这个工具。所以,有很多网友比较关心“传说中”的KeilMDK6。KeilMDK6来了吗?说到KeilMDK6,就要说到KeilStudio。早在2021年的时候,Ke

keil构建STM32工程并使用proteus仿真led点灯实验

  STM32单片机与51单片机有很大区别,不仅结构上有很大差异,STM32更复杂一些,在操作上来说,STM32也要复杂很多,51单片机上手写代码,可以很直接操作引脚,但是STM32单片机在操作引脚之前需要作很多初始化工作,比如开启时钟使能,GPIO管脚初始化。  下面就入门STM32单片机开发做一个简单的介绍,本文是仿真,不需要真实的STM32单片机,只需要电脑安装开发相关的软件即可,主要是keil-mdk,proteus。  keil这里安装的是支持STM32单片机的版本,这个需要安装mdk那个版本。这里提供一个支持mdk的keil下载链接,提取码:1234。它的安装和破解和keil-51

vesc6本杰明6.4 PCB 原理图+keil代码vesc6.4

pcb板双层可直接发到嘉立创打样,我制作的板子,通过上位机可测电机参数,有测参数页面。没有添加陀螺仪,可以自行按照原版添加程序源码为keil版本,符合国内工程师开发习惯,单套硬件成本可控制在百元以内,具体看用料。